SoleFly and Jordan Brand teamed up last year for the Air Jordan 1 Low collaboration, and now the owner Carlos Prieto took to social media to show off a “What The” sample. 

This variation takes inspiration from previous SoleFly x Air Jordan collaborations with various different prints being used throughout. Featuring a leather rendition, an off-white color is used on the sides while red or beige is used on the toes. For branding, the Nike Swoosh logos arrive in either black, yellow, green, or red. Pink glossy heel overlays feature yellow Wings logos nods to the Air Jordan 3 “Lotto” while the duo looks back to past renditions for inspiration on their Nike branded tongue labels such as the Miami Hurricanes Jordan 1 High. To complete the design a white midsole and red outsole are placed on both the left and right pair.

You can enjoy detailed images of the sample pair below but as of now, the Air Jordan 1 Low What The SoleFly is labeled exclusively as a sample. That can change soon though and with all the hype the pair has received so far today, the duo may be getting a few ideas.
